We make Chicken under a brick a lot - split a chicken (or ask your butcher) just salt, pepper, garlic powder, olive oil both sides, then grill under a brick wrapped in foil.

My dad always used to make the most yummy grilled flank steak. The marinade is zest and juice from 2 oranges, grated ginger root, soy sauce or teriyaki sauce (whichever you have on hand will work). Marinate for a few hours or over night is better. We would eat it with bulgar wheat and grilled veggie skewers.
